UFO & Evo­­ Mo­­bil by Ora Ito

On the edge of the hy­poth­e­­sis and con­tem­po­rary art, French product designer Ora-Ïto launch­es the world­wide pre­miere an un­u­­su­al ex­pe­ri­ence based on the ge­net­ic tran­s­­for­­ma­­tions. Ora-Ïto has cre­at­ed two hybrid cars: The “UFO” & the “Evo­­mo­­bil”, both in­­spired by the icon­ic ‘DS’ and ‘Traction Avant’ cars from Cit­roën. He build these sculp­­tures combining the dream of the for­­mal and the fu­­ture of tech­nol­ogy.

The GT by Citroen: The Virtual Crossover

If you’re one of the millions that owns a copy of Gran Turismo 5 for the PS3, you’re going to love this one…  In a surprise move by this French automaker, Citroen has revealed this virtual machine as a real world concept car today at the Paris Auto Show.  A joint venture with the makers of Gran Turismo, the GTbyCitroen is expected to hit 62mph from zero in just 3.6 seconds.  The GT achieves this from a hybrid combustion/fuel cell engine with a total of 752 horses.  We’re guessing the GTbyCitroen will never see the light of day as far as production, but with the release of this concept, we can at least be optimistic. – via Gear Crave

Citroen 2cv by Hermès

citron-2cv-hermes-1

Happy Birthday 2CV ! To celebrate the 60th anniversary of the “Doh Doch” ( or Deux Cheveaux ), Hermes created a special version of a 1989 Citroen 2CV6 Special for the Paris Auto Show.
